Biological Factors in Addiction Therapy



When addressing biological consider addiction treatment, it's crucial to comprehend just how the body's chemistry influences the effectiveness of treatments. The means substances interact with your brain's neurotransmitters plays a considerable role in dependency development. As an example, drugs can hijack the brain's reward system, resulting in cravings and uncontrollable drug-seeking habits. Comprehending these chemical processes assists in customizing therapy approaches like medication-assisted treatment to target particular neurotransmitter imbalances.

Furthermore, hereditary factors can additionally affect exactly how your body responds to certain substances, influencing your vulnerability to addiction. By taking into consideration these organic facets, medical care experts can individualize treatment plans that deal with the special needs of people fighting addiction, ultimately increasing the chances of successful healing.

Mental Treatments for Addiction



Comprehending the emotional interventions for addiction is essential in complementing the biological factors attended to in therapy plans. Below are three crucial emotional treatments that play an essential function in addiction therapy:

1. ** Cognitive-Behavioral Therapy (CBT): ** This therapy aids you determine and transform negative idea patterns and behaviors connected with substance abuse.

2. ** Motivational Interviewing (MI): ** MI is a therapy approach that helps you find the inner inspiration to alter addictive behaviors.

3. ** Mindfulness-Based Treatments: ** These methods focus on enhancing your recognition of desires and activates without judgment, helping you manage them properly.

Social Assistance and Recovery in Dependency



Social support plays an important duty in addiction healing, providing people with the necessary encouragement and support to navigate the obstacles of getting over substance abuse. Having a solid support group can dramatically boost the chance of effective healing from dependency. Pals, member of the family, support groups, and therapists all contribute to developing a network of support that can assist you stay inspired and focused on your journey to sobriety.

Social links can use understanding, empathy, and useful assistance during difficult times, acting as a source of strength and guidance. By surrounding on your own with positive and encouraging individuals that count on your ability to recoup, you can boost your durability and commitment to remaining substance-free.
